RememberVideos.com is a custom memorial video production service for individuals and families, rather than a self-service online video editing tool. Its positioning is clear: it helps users celebrate life milestones such as births, weddings, and graduations, as well as remembrance, funeral, and memorial occasions. Users provide photos and video materials, and the service team produces the finished video, publishes it online, and delivers a digital copy.
Based on the information on the site, its core value proposition is essentially “send us your materials, and we’ll make the video.” The ordering process appears relatively simple: after a user places an order, the team sends instructions by email, follows up by phone to answer questions, and offers suggestions on how to make the video more special. This suggests the service leans more toward human planning and editing than a template-based tool. Collaboration mainly happens via email and phone; there is no visible support for online review, annotations, multi-user collaboration, or version management. For export and delivery, the site only states that the video will be published online and delivered digitally, without disclosing technical details such as format, resolution, or download availability period.
The site lists pricing as “from just $199.99,” indicating a project-based starting price model, and it emphasizes satisfaction guarantee and secure payment. However, it does not provide detailed packages, video length limits, number of revisions, rush fees, or refund terms. Copyright and licensing information is also limited: it does not clarify usage rights for user-uploaded materials, ownership of the final video, background music and template licensing, or privacy protection. This is especially important for sensitive content such as memorial and funeral videos.
Its advantages are a low barrier to entry and a straightforward process, making it suitable for people with no video editing experience. The availability of phone communication also gives emotional videos a more personal touch than purely self-service tools. Public starting pricing also helps users make an initial budget assessment. The drawbacks are limited transparency: the site lacks clear information on portfolio scale, production timeline, delivery specifications, and post-delivery revision policies. It also does not disclose details about its media library, templates, or music licensing.
It is suitable for users who need graduation, wedding, family memorial, or remembrance videos but do not want to learn video editing software. If users have specific requirements for copyright, privacy, HD delivery, or multiple rounds of revisions, they should confirm details by phone or email before placing an order.
